== Translingual == === Alternative forms === Thuia (obsolete) Thuya (obsolete) === Etymology === Irregular representation of Ancient Greek θυία (thuía), θύα (thúa), the name of an African tree now designated Tetraclinis articulata and known in English as the arar tree. === Proper noun === Thuja f A taxonomic genus within the family Cupressaceae – thujas, coniferous trees in the cypress family. ==== Hypernyms ==== (genus): Eukaryota – superkingdom; Plantae – kingdom; Viridiplantae – subkingdom; Streptophyta – infrakingdom; Embryophyta – superphylum; Tracheophyta – phylum; Spermatophytina – subphylum; Pinopsida – class; Pinidae – subclass; Pinales – order; Cupressaceae – family; Cupressoideae – subfamily ==== Hyponyms ==== (genus): Thuja occidentalis (northern whitecedar) – type species; Thuja koraiensis (Korean thuja), Thuja plicata (western redcedar), Thuja standishii (Japanese thuja), Thuja sutchuenensis (Sichuan thuja) – other species ==== Derived terms ==== Thujopsis === References === Thuja on Wikipedia.Wikipedia Thuja on Wikispecies.Wikispecies Category:Thuja on Wikimedia Commons.Wikimedia Commons == German == === Etymology === From taxonomic New Latin Thuja, from Ancient Greek θυία (thuía). === Pronunciation === IPA(key): /ˈtuːja/ === Noun === Thuja f (genitive Thuja, plural Thujen) thuja Synonym: Lebensbaum ==== Declension ==== === Further reading === “Thuja” in Duden online “Thuja” in Digitales Wörterbuch der deutschen Sprache
